What is the name of your state? Florida

The biofather wants to terminate his parental rights to allow "their dad", my husband of the last 6 years to adopt all three of the children.

The forms required to do this are supposed to be available at http://www.FLcourts.org However, some of the laws were changed on May 30th of 2003 and the Supreme Court has not released the "new forms" yet.

ADOPTION STATUTES – HB 835 (Mahon) & HB 1017 (House Procedures): Amends portions of Chapter 63 applying to stepchild adoptions; revises definitions including unmarried biological father; revises the adoption disclosure form; creates Florida Putative Father Registry and requires search of registry prior to adoption under certain circumstances; changes date to contest judgment terminating parental rights from 2 years to 1 year. HB 1017 provides that the 2003 Florida Statutes shall be in effect immediately upon enactment and repeals every statute enacted at or prior to the April 29-May 13, 2002 Special Session, but shall not affect any right accrued before such repeal or any civil remedy where a suit is pending. The Conference supported this bill.
I have exhausted everything I can think of trying to figure out what form the bio father will need to fill out to terminate his rights. I fear if he fills out "the old form" a judge may reject it since the "new changes" are not included.

To complicate the matter, the bio father is leaving for Iraq in the beginning of January and is currently stationed in Washington State... Time is short to get him the correct form. By mid December he may not be able to do anything at all and he wont be back in the states for AT LEAST one year.

Does ANYONE have a copy of the "form he will need" to satisfy a Seminole County Florida court to file for the "Petition to Terminate Parental Rights Pending Stepparent Adoption"???? I can pay for the form but was hoping to complete the adoption process on our own since "everyone is in agreement" about the situation. I just need that one CURRENT form to get to the biodad before he leaves ..and I cannot seem to obtain it :(
